Apple and Yahoo’s June announcements make it clear that…
Tabbed inbox interfaces are now the status quo, and GenAI‑powered preview content and summaries are the next wave of inbox changes. I have long argued that tabs aren’t worth worrying about, but Gmail’s policy of Automatic Extraction for marketing emails in the Promotions tab has me concerned. GenAI‑powered summaries that replace preview content or push down an email’s body content are also sure to frustrate marketers, especially when their messages are automatically subjected to these treatments by inbox providers rather than selectively used by subscribers. Overall, these moves are further evidence of inbox providers’ willingness to invest in features that address what they see as email’s shortcomings.
